HIP 113665
HIP 113665 is a A-type (White) star located in the constellation Andromeda.
Located approximately 526.1 light-years from Earth, HIP 113665 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 113665 is classified as a spectral class A star (A-type (White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 113665 has an apparent magnitude of +7.35,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.375.
